>>>> Accessing an uninitialized address from outside the enclave also triggers
>>>> this flow but the page will remain in PENDING state until accepted from
>>>> within the enclave.
>>>
>>> What does it mean being in PENDING state, and more imporantly, what is
>>> PENDING state? What does a memory access within enclave cause when it
>>> touch a page within this state?
>>
>> The PENDING state is the enclave page state from the SGX hardware's
>> perspective. The OS uses the ENCLS[EAUG] SGX2 function to add a new page
>> to the enclave but from the SGX hardware's perspective it would be in a
>> PENDING state until the enclave accepts the page. An access to the page
>> in PENDING state would result in a page fault.
